How they compare

Cambodia currently reports 28,818 m3 against 22,028 m3 in South Africa, a difference of 6,790 m3.

That makes Cambodia's figure about 1.3 times South Africa's.

The two have swapped places 9 times across 20 shared years of data; in 1997 it was South Africa ahead.

Cambodia ranks 44th and South Africa ranks 47th of 137 countries.

South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
